Commercial demolition services involve the careful removal of entire structures or specific parts of buildings that are no longer needed or are being replaced. This process includes tearing down walls, floors, and foundations, as well as removing debris and preparing the site for new construction or development. Local contractors specializing in commercial demolition have the expertise and equipment to handle projects safely and efficiently, ensuring that the site is cleared according to plan and in compliance with local regulations. These services are essential when a business or property owner wants to repurpose a building or clear space for new development.

Many problems can be addressed through commercial demolition services. For example, outdated or unsafe structures may need to be taken down to eliminate hazards or meet modern building codes. Property owners might also require demolition to clear land for new commercial projects, such as retail centers, office buildings, or warehouses. Additionally, partial demolition can be useful for renovations, where only certain sections of a building are removed to accommodate new layouts or systems. Using professional demolition services helps prevent damage to surrounding structures and minimizes disruptions to the neighboring area.

The types of properties that typically utilize commercial demolition services include retail complexes, office buildings, industrial facilities, warehouses, and multi-unit residential buildings. These projects often involve large-scale structures that require heavy-duty equipment and experienced operators. Property owners or developers may also need demolition when repurposing or renovating older buildings that are no longer suitable for their intended use. Whether clearing a vacant lot or tearing down a large commercial structure, these services help streamline the process and ensure the site is prepared for the next phase of development.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Demolition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Englewood,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Demolition Jobs - Many local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for routine demolition tasks like removing small structures or interior walls. These projects are common and typically fall within this middle range. Larger or more complex jobs tend to cost more and are less frequent in this category.

Medium-Scale Demolition - For moderate projects such as partial building removal or large interior demolitions, costs generally range from $1,500 to $4,000. Many projects in Englewood land in this band, with fewer exceeding $5,000 due to added complexity or size.

Larger Commercial Demolition - Complete building demolitions or extensive site clearing can range from $10,000 to $50,000 or more, depending on the structure size and site conditions. These larger projects are less common but are handled regularly by experienced local service providers.

Full Building Replacement - Entire commercial property demolitions and site preparations often cost $100,000+, especially for large or multi-story structures.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ve detailed planning and specialized equipment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of structures can commercial demolition services handle? Local contractors in Englewood, CO, can manage demolition of various commercial structures including warehouses, office buildings, retail spaces, and industrial facilities.

Are there specific permits required for commercial demolition projects? Yes, many projects in Englewood, CO, may require permits from local authorities, and experienced service providers can assist with the permitting process.

What safety measures are typically followed during commercial demolition? Local service providers adhere to safety protocols such as proper site assessment, equipment handling, and debris management to ensure safe demolition work.

Can commercial demolition services handle hazardous materials removal? Many local contractors are equipped to identify and safely remove hazardous materials like asbestos or lead-based paint during demolition projects.

What equipment is commonly used for commercial demolition? Heavy machinery such as excavators, bulldozers, and wrecking balls are commonly employed by local pros to efficiently carry out commercial demolitions in Englewood, CO.
